Intended Use
The Liofilchem® MIC Test Strip (MTS) is a quantitative method intended for the in vitro determination of antimicrobial susceptibility of bacteria. MTS consists of specialized paper impregnated with a pre-defined concentration gradient of an antimicrobial agent, which is used to determine the minimum inhibitory concentration (MIC) in ug/mL of antimicrobial agents against bacteria as tested on agar media using overnight incubation and manual reading procedures. The Tedizolid MTS at concentrations of 0.002-32 ug/mL should be interpreted at 16-20 hours of incubation. The non-fastidious bacteria that have been shown to be active both clinically and in vitro against Tedizolid according to the FDA label are: Staphylococcus aureus (including methicillin-resistant and methicillin susceptible isolates) Enterococcus faecalis
Device Story
Liofilchem MIC Test Strip (MTS) is a quantitative diagnostic tool for determining antimicrobial susceptibility. Device consists of specialized paper strips impregnated with a predefined concentration gradient of Tedizolid (0.002-32 µg/mL). Used in clinical microbiology laboratories; operated by trained laboratory personnel. Procedure involves placing the strip onto inoculated agar media, followed by overnight incubation (16-20 hours). The MIC is determined by manual visual inspection of the inhibition ellipse formed around the strip. Results assist clinicians in selecting appropriate antibiotic therapy for patients with bacterial infections. Benefits include precise determination of susceptibility levels to guide effective treatment.
Clinical Evidence
No clinical data provided. Performance is established via bench testing comparing the MTS method to reference broth microdilution methods for determining MIC values of Tedizolid against specified bacterial isolates.
Technological Characteristics
Specialized paper strip impregnated with a predefined concentration gradient of Tedizolid (0.002-32 µg/mL). Quantitative method for MIC determination. Manual reading procedure. Requires agar media and overnight incubation (16-20 hours).
Indications for Use
Indicated for in vitro antimicrobial susceptibility testing of non-fastidious bacteria, specifically Staphylococcus aureus (including MRSA and MSSA) and Enterococcus faecalis, to determine the minimum inhibitory concentration (MIC) of Tedizolid.
Regulatory Classification
Identification
An antimicrobial susceptibility test powder is a device that consists of an antimicrobial drug powder packaged in vials in specified amounts and intended for use in clinical laboratories for determining in vitro susceptibility of bacterial pathogens to these therapeutic agents. Test results are used to determine the antimicrobial agent of choice in the treatment of bacterial diseases.
